Lufthansa Airlines is one of the world’s oldest national flight carriers whose origins can be traced back to 1926. Its headquarters is located in Cologne, Germany. Currently, the Lufthansa fleet comprises 294 aircraft with 14 Airbus A380-800, 19 Boeing 747-8, 13 Boeing 747-400, 17 Airbus 340-600, 14 Airbus A350-900 as well as an assortment of smaller aircrafts. Its iconic emblem was updated in 2018 and shows a white crane taking flight against a background of blue.
Lufthansa flights cover 18 domestic destinations in Germany and over 190 destinations in 81 countries around the world. The most frequent routes that Lufthansa services include - flights from Frankfurt to London, Frankfurt to New York, and Munich to San Francisco. Some of the lesser known destinations that Lufthansa seasonally services include flights to Faro in Portugal, Knock in Ireland, Malé in the Maldives, Inverness in Scotland, and Zadar in Croatia.
Travelers on a Lufthansa flight are set a carry-on baggage and check-in luggage limit based on the service class.
All carry-on baggage should fit into the following dimensions: 55 × 40 × 23 cm (for suitcases and trolley cases) or 57 × 54 × 15 cm (for garment bags).
The sum of the dimensions of any piece of check-in baggage should be 158 cm (length + breadth + width).
Lufthansa offers the provision of supervising a child unaccompanied by an adult on all its flights. Children between the ages of 5 and 11 may fly unaccompanied if they are using the Lufthansa supervision service or they are accompanied by a passenger at least 12 years old. Children between the ages of 12 and 17 may avail the supervision service at the request of their parents. Children under the age of 5 will not be permitted to fly unless accompanied by an adult of 18 years or a sibling of at least 16 years of age.
Pets can be transported via a Lufthansa flight subject to destination restrictions and company terms and conditions. Each passenger is allowed to transport up to 2 pets in approved transport containers in the cabin and cargo hold. The minimum age for cats and dogs permissible for transport is 12 weeks (16 weeks for the USA); for hares and rabbits, the minimum age is 5 weeks.

While booking Lufthansa flight tickets, , the provision of online check-in is available. Online check-in can be completed 23 hours before a flight and passengers can choose their preferred seat, print out their boarding passes or download an electronic copy, and stay ready for their journey.
As a founding member of the Star Alliance, Lufthansa enjoys access to 1,330 airports in 192 countries through its own fleet or that of its airline partners. Lufthansa’s Miles & More frequent flyer membership, which offers rewards to passengers of the Star Alliance, is the largest traveler loyalty programme in the world and provides access to 40 airline partners. With new classes such as Economy Light and Premium Economy, a Lufthansa flight search today yields more affordable options to more destinations for all its loyal travelers.
Lufthansa pays attention to an ecologically sustainable model of business and has the most stringent policies on noise emission across its operational fleet. It earned the title of “Best Airline in Europe” for the second time in a row in 2018 at the World Airline Awards and in 2019 it was conferred the title “Airline of the Year” by Air Transport World.
